CO MMISSARIATCON TRACTS. AUCKLAND DISTRICT.

Commissariat Office, Auckland, 6th May, 1851. JN consequence of the prescribed Three Months notice having been given, the Contracts now in force for furnishing the undermentioned Atticles, for the Auckland District, will terminate on the 31st of next July, viz.: FRE-H MEAT, BREAD, Supplies for General Purposes, Notice is accordingly given that Tenders for the supply of those Aiticles at Auckland, from Ist August, 1851 to 31st March, 1852, will be received at this office, until noon of Saturday, the 28th of June next. The conditions of Contract will be the same as are specified in the Commissariat advertisement, published in the New Zea/andcr Newspaper, and dated 14th January, 1851. Philip Turner, Assistant Commissary General.
